Tomato – Mozzarella – Steaks

Ingredients for 4 servings:

  • 4 pork steaks (back)
  • 400g spaghetti
  • 2 balls of mozzarella
  • 2 large tomatoes
  • 150 ml cream or milk
  • 4 t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• salt and pepper
  • onion powder
  • garlic powder
  • Paprika powder
  • Liquid seasoning

Instructions

Working time approx. 20 minutes; Total time approx. 20 minutes

Cook the spaghetti until tender, drain, and keep warm. Season the sirloin steaks and cook on both sides over medium heat for about 10 minutes. Place the steaks in a baking dish. Brush each with 1/2 teaspoon of tomato paste and alternate layers of tomato and mozzarella until each steak is covered. Season with salt and drizzle with oil. Bake in a preheated oven at 175°C for 10-15 minutes with fan/convection oven. Place the remaining tomato paste in a saucepan, pour in the cream, and add the remaining mozzarella, diced. If there are any tomatoes left, dice them and add them. Season to taste. Add the spaghetti to the pan and toss well with the sauce. Heat until the mozzarella has melted. Serve with a green salad.
